Web18 de dez. de 2015 · The dating of the letter is highly dependent on whether one adopts the North Galatian or the. South Galatian theory for the recipients of the letter. For this scenario, the date of the letter. would be around Pauls third missionary trip (Acts 18:23-21:14) in ca. 53-57 A.D. An earlier. date is possible for the North Galatian scenario ... WebGalatians, it is maintained, was written between a.d. 53 and 57 from Ephesus or Macedonia. The South Galatian theory. According to this view, Galatians was written to churches in the southern area of the Roman province of Galatia (Antioch, Iconium, Lystra and Derbe) that Paul had founded on his first missionary journey.
